EXTENSION CALL PICKUP*
To pick up (answer) a call ringing at another extension, lift the handset and
dial 65 followed by the number of the ringing extension.
Note: If the Hot Keypad feature has been turned off, you must first lift the handset
or press the SPEAKER key before you begin dialling.

GROUP CALL PICKUP*

To pick up (answer) a call ringing in any pickup group, lift the handset and
dial 66 followed by the desired group number 01–99, or press the flashing
GROUP PICKUP key if available.
Note:
A group pickup key can have an extender for a specific pickup group (see
Adding Extenders to Key Assignments
If the Hot Keypad feature has been turned off, you must first lift the handset or
press the SPEAKER key before dialling the access code.

MY GROUP PICKUP*

A separate access code may be assigned to pick up ringing calls in your
own pickup group. See your system administrator for the assigned access
code, if one is available, and enter it here: MYGRPK code = _____.
To pick up a call, dial the code (you do not need to dial the group number).
*
For new ringing calls and operator recalls only. Station and group pickup features
can be used to answer recalls to a station only if the required option is enabled on
your sys tem. Check with your system adminis trator if this is the case.
